Engineering Manager, CamelBak

Irvine, CA

Job Description

As the Engineering Manager, you will be responsible for the development of industry-leading concepts from ideation through prototyping, initial development, and final development. This position works directly with the Director of R&D with close input from Merchandising, Sales, Brand Management, and Marketing, to drive our projects from conception to commercialization. You will develop and prove out technical, manufacturable, and consumer-valued product concepts and technical abilities that ultimately support future products that provide a benefit to the consumer, while striving to achieve or exceed standards beyond state of the art for return value to the company.

This position reports to the Sr. Director of Hardgoods and is based out of Adventure Sports headquarters in Irvine, CA.

As the Engineer Manager, you will have an opportunity to:

  • Lead product development and engineering for reservoirs, bottles, drinkware, and accessories.
  • Provide strategic direction for platform-level projects and 5-year product planning.
  • Present regular updates to cross-functional and executive teams.
  • Support CamelBak business Unit operations and communications.
  • Manage and mentor design and development engineers.
  • Attract, develop, and retain top talent through coaching and stretch assignments.
  • Direct internal and external resources for design, prototyping, tooling, and manufacturing.
  • Oversee internal workload and external partnerships to ensure timely project delivery.
  • Drive innovation and market leadership through cross-functional collaboration.
  • Brainstorm with Marketing and Design to generate creative concepts.
  • Evaluate product success based on innovation, function, brand relevance, quality, and margins.
  • Manage CAD and documentation processes for efficiency and accuracy.
  • Ensure compliance with safety standards and regulations (e.g., CE, CPSC).
  • Manage product certifications and testing.
  • Deeply understand and apply safety standards in design evaluations.
  • Maintain continuous communication with overseas suppliers.
  • Visit manufacturing facilities to support sampling, commercialization, and process improvement.
  • Build strategic partnerships with key technology vendors.
  • Manage costing processes, including PLM entries and vendor quotations.
  • Oversee CAPEX tooling budgets and conduct NPV analyses.
  • Contribute to annual budgeting and operate within defined budgets.
  • Collaborate with Supply Chain, Customer Experience, and Brand Management to solve problems.
  • Coordinate graphics development for timely sample delivery.
  • Review and prioritize performance and styling goals in product design

You have:

  • Education: 4-year degree in Mechanical Engineering (BSME) or equivalent work experience
  • Experience: 5-10 years minimum consumer product development/engineering experience.
  • An enthusiastic and positive attitude with a passion towards MX, MTB and Action Sports. Must be very creative, forward thinking, an energy giver - not a taker.
  • CAD experience, preferably proficient in Solidworks.
  • Experience engineering injection molds, working with plastic parts and 3D modeling
  • Knowledge of plastics, textiles, and embellishment techniques

You might have:

  • Previous development/engineering experience in helmets or molded plastic protective sport products
  • Prior experience working with overseas factories and vendors
  • Experience engineering compression molds and parts

Pay Range:

Annual Salary: $135,000.00 - $150,000.00

The actual annual salary offered to a candidate will be based on variables including experience, geographic location, education, and skills/achievements, and will be mutually agreed upon at the time of offer.

We offer a highly competitive salary, comprehensive benefits including: medical and dental, vision, disability and life insurance, 401K, PTO, paid holidays, gear discounts and the ability to add value to an exciting mission!
